加入收藏 | 设为首页 | 会员中心 | 我要投稿 站长网 (https://www.3033.com.cn/)- 应用程序、AI行业应用、CDN、低代码、区块链!
当前位置: 首页 > 综合聚焦 > 编程要点 > 语言 > 正文

后端架构核心:语选函设变管精要

发布时间:2026-04-13 15:42:40 所属栏目:语言 来源:DaWei
导读:2026AI模拟图,仅供参考  后端架构的核心在于构建一个稳定、高效且可扩展的系统,而语言选择、函数设计、变量管理是其中的关键环节。语言是后端开发的基石,不同语言在性能、生态和适用场景上各有优势。例如,Java

2026AI模拟图,仅供参考

  后端架构的核心在于构建一个稳定、高效且可扩展的系统,而语言选择、函数设计、变量管理是其中的关键环节。语言是后端开发的基石,不同语言在性能、生态和适用场景上各有优势。例如,Java凭借成熟的框架和强类型特性适合大型企业应用;Python以简洁语法和丰富库支持快速开发;Go语言则因高并发处理能力成为云原生领域的热门选择。选择语言时需综合考虑团队技术栈、项目需求及长期维护成本,避免盲目追求技术热点。


  函数设计是后端架构的逻辑骨架,直接影响代码的可读性和可维护性。好的函数应遵循单一职责原则,每个函数只完成一个明确的任务,长度控制在合理范围内。通过合理的参数设计减少函数间的耦合,例如使用对象封装相关参数而非散列多个变量。函数返回值应保持一致性,避免同时返回状态码和数据对象,减少调用方的处理复杂度。合理使用异步编程模型能显著提升高并发场景下的系统吞吐量,但需注意错误处理和资源释放。


  变量管理是保障系统稳定性的重要环节。变量命名需清晰表达其用途和类型,避免使用缩写或模糊名称。合理使用常量可以减少魔法数字的出现,提升代码可维护性。在作用域控制上,应尽量缩小变量的可见范围,例如在循环内部定义的变量不应泄露到外部。对于共享资源,需通过锁机制或无锁数据结构确保线程安全,防止并发修改导致的数据不一致问题。合理设置变量的默认值和边界条件检查,能有效预防空指针异常等常见错误。


  后端架构的优化是一个持续迭代的过程。语言选择需匹配业务场景,函数设计要追求简洁高效,变量管理要确保安全可靠。这三个环节相互支撑,共同构成系统稳定运行的基石。开发者应通过代码审查、性能测试等手段不断优化架构设计,在满足当前需求的同时预留扩展空间,为系统的长期演进奠定基础。

(编辑:站长网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章